2025-11-29 09:55:38
在当今数字时代,TokenIM作为一种重要的身份验证和授权机制,在许多应用程序和平台中得到了广泛利用。然而,TokenIM的广泛使用也带来了相应的安全隐患。如何有效预防TokenIM的潜在威胁,成为了许多企业和个人需要关注的重要问题。本文将详细探讨有效预防TokenIM的六大策略,并回答相关问题,以帮助用户更好地理解这一主题。
TokenIM,即Token Identity Management,是一种基于令牌的身份验证系统。它采用了令牌(token)来代替传统的用户名和密码,以提高身份验证的安全性。令牌通常由后台生成,用户在成功登录后获得一个唯一的令牌。该令牌在有效时间内,用户可以使用它进行后续的身份验证操作。如同在现实生活中,凭借身份证进入某个场所,TokenIM的令牌也在某种程度上起到类似的作用。
从工作原理来看,TokenIM包含几个关键组件:用户端、认证服务器和资源服务器。用户通过连接网络向认证服务器请求访问资源,认证服务器验证用户身份,并生成相应的令牌。如果验证通过,用户将获得一个有效的令牌,从而可以访问所需的资源。这种机制确保了用户的身份得到确认,同时减少了对密码的依赖,从而降低了密码泄露的风险。
为了有效预防TokenIM带来的安全隐患,企业与个人可以采取以下六种策略:
定期更新Token的生成和验证策略,可以有效降低Token被盗用的风险。企业可以通过引入动态令牌的机制,确保每次身份验证时生成的新令牌。因此即使某个令牌被截获,只要它的有效期已过,黑客也无法利用这些令牌进行身份验证。
采用强加密算法对Token进行加密存储和传输,可以防止令牌在传输过程中被窃取。比如使用HTTPS协议进行数据传输,并采用现代加密技术(如AES等)对Token进行加密。如此,即使攻击者截获数据,未经过正确解密的Token也无法被利用。
多重身份验证(MFA)是一种增强安全性的机制,通过要求用户提供多种身份验证因素来确保其身份。结合TokenIM,用户在输入用户名和密码后,还需通过其他方式(如短信验证码、生物识别等)进行身份验证。在这种情况下,即使令牌被盗,攻击者也无法完成验证,从而保障了账户的安全。
通过实时监控和分析用户活动日志,可以快速识别异常行为并进行响应。企业应建立一套完善的日志记录系统,包括记录Token的生成、使用和失效等信息。一旦系统检测到异常活动(如同一令牌在多个地理位置被使用等),可以自动触发警报,并及时采取措施保护账户安全。
设置合理的Token有效期,可以最大限度地减少令牌被滥用的风险。企业应当根据不同应用场景设置Token的有效时长,重要系统或敏感操作可以使用短暂有效的Token,而一般操作可设置较长有效期。此外,应设计合理的Token失效机制,确保在用户注销或长时间未使用后,Token自动失效。
教育用户和企业员工关于TokenIM的安全知识与操作规范至关重要。通过定期的安全培训,提升用户的安全意识,使其了解如何识别钓鱼攻击、如何妥善保存令牌以及如何报告异常情况。用户在了解潜在风险后,能够更好地保护自己的在线身份,降低TokenIM带来的安全风险。
虽然TokenIM为身份验证提供了一种更为安全的方式,但并不能保证绝对安全。与所有安全措施一样,TokenIM也有其局限性。黑客可以通过多种手段攻陷TokenIM,如社交工程、网络钓鱼、以及会话劫持等。为了最大限度地减少这种风险,我们应采取上述提到的预防措施,定期更新安全策略,保持防御机制的与改进。同时,进行安全审计和风险评估也是确保TokenIM安全的重要环节。结合多重身份验证可以大大降低风险,因此绝对安全常常是一个相对的概念。
识别TokenIM被盗用的迹象至关重要。用户可以通过以下几个方面进行监测:首先,查看登录活动记录,如果发现有未知的设备或位置尝试登录,应立即采取措施,比如更改密码或注销会话。检查账户中的最近活动,有无异常的交易记录或内容变更。如果收到来自系统的安全警报,提示存在异常活动,应立即联系支持团队。此外,企业可以借助安全信息和事件管理(SIEM)系统,监测和记录用户行为,及时发现并处理潜在的安全威胁。
企业管理TokenIM的生命周期可以遵循以下几个步骤:首先是令牌的生成,包括选择合适的加密算法和设置合理的有效期。其次是令牌的使用,确保用户在使用令牌的过程中遵循最佳实践,避免令牌被滥用。接下来是令牌的失效,在用户注销和登录的情况下,及时终止令牌的有效性,防止未授权的访问。最后,定期对TokenIM的使用情况进行审查与分析,评估安全性并现有策略,以保障系统的综合安全。这样,企业可以有效管理Token的整个生命周期,提高安全性。
用户在使用TokenIM时,可以采取多种方式来保护自己的令牌不被盗用。首先,确保所用设备和网络的安全,避免在公共Wi-Fi环境下进行敏感操作。其次,定期更换密码,并开启多重身份验证增强账户安全。此外,保持软件及应用程序的最新版本,确保所有已知漏洞都被修复。如果收到可疑的登录通知或其他安全警告,用户应立即采取行动,如修改密码,或更换令牌等。此外,用户也应了解应用程序的授权范围,确认其是否在允许的范围内访问自己的Token信息,提升账户的安全性。
随着科技的发展,TokenIM的未来发展趋势将主要体现在以下几个方面:首先是自适应身份验证,即根据用户的历史行为和上下文进行智能评估,动态调整验证模式,提升安全性;其次是与区块链技术的结合,利用其去中心化和不可篡改的特性增强身份验证的透明性和可信度。此外,生物识别技术的不断成熟,也将成为TokenIM发展的新方向,通过指纹、面部识别等手段,提升身份验证的安全性与便捷性。整体来看,TokenIM将不断向智能化和自动化方向发展,以应对日益复杂的网络安全挑战。
综上所述,TokenIM作为一种重要的安全身份验证机制,虽然能在一定程度上提高安全性,但依然需要注意预防潜在的威胁。通过实施有效的安全策略与技术手段,用户和企业可在这个数字化的时代,更加安全地管理自己的在线身份与信息安全。